La bêta-alanine est-elle utilisée pour traiter des maladies ?

Elle n'est pas un traitement médical, mais un complément pour améliorer la performance sportive.
Compléments alimentaires Bêta-alanine Performance sportive
#2

Comment la bêta-alanine améliore-t-elle la performance ?

Elle augmente les niveaux de carnosine dans les muscles, retardant la fatigue lors d'exercices intenses.
